Samsung Galaxy A05 and A05s are Now Official; Here are the First Impressions

Sohail Akhtar

The company’s much-anticipated Samsung Galaxy A05 and Galaxy A05s are finally out. Malaysia gets the first dibs, with both phones now listed on Samsung’s microsite in the region. Yet, their prices remain a mystery. While snippets of information have been leaking for some time, we finally have comprehensive official stats to discuss.


In terms of aesthetics, the A05 shines in Black, Light Green, and Silver, whereas its sibling, the A05s, sticks to just Black and Light Green. As for the real distinguisher, the A05s houses a triple camera setup, adding an edge over the A05's dual-lens arrangement.

Under the hood, there's also a distinction in power. The A05s opts for a Qualcomm Snapdragon 680 processor, while the A05 sports the MediaTek Helio G85 chipset. Both have astonishing capabilities, but the Snapdragon 680 punches harder in every benchmark.  


Storage isn't an issue for either. Both Samsung budget new models grace Malaysia's market with a 6/128GB configuration. Display enthusiasts will immediately notice the A05’s sub-standard 6.7-inch HD+ screen, while the A05s escalates to FHD+ resolution, promising crisp visuals.


Camera-wise, both devices boast a 50MP primary shooter with an additional 2MP depth sensor. But the A05s sneaks in an extra 2MP macro lens, making it slightly superior for close-ups. Energizing these devices are substantial 5,000mAh cells equipped with 25W fast charging.

The newcomers debut with the latest Android 13 x One UI 5 and are due to receive further software enhancements down the road. Global release dates remain hazy, but one thing's clear: with its added specs, the A05s will likely command a higher price.
